From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Letter to Ferodo Ltd. requesting the co-efficient of friction and wearing qualities for newly received anti-squeaking brake linings.

27th. April 1926.

Messrs. Ferodo Ltd.,
Sovereign Mills,
Chapel-en-le-Frith.

Dear Sirs,

For the attention of Mr. Field.

We thank you for the special anti-squeaking brake linings for our 40/50 HP. and 20 HP. cars which we have now received.

As a matter of interest, could you let us know the approximate co-efficient of friction of these materials compared with our standard materials. The reason we wish to know this is so that we can adjust our braking power to suit the altered conditions.

We should also like to know whether you can give us any indication of the wearing qualities we may expect from these materials.

We are particularly anxious to obtain the moulded clutch plates for the 40/50 HP. and should be much indebted to you if you could expedite these in every way possible.

Yours faithfully,
